In a medium bowl, mix the orange juice, orange zest, lemon juice, mustard, maple syrup, salt and a grind of fresh black pepper. Gradually whisk in the olive oil 1 tablespoon at a time (8 tablespoons total), until creamy and emulsified. If desired, season with additional salt. Store refrigerated for up to 1 week; bring to room temperature prior.

To make the citrus balsamic vinaigrette, measure the oil, balsamic, OJ, and honey into a small bowl. Grab a wire whisk or a fork, and whisk the ingredients together until the dressing has "emulsified". This will only take a minute or so. First, using a microplane or box grater, finely zest the orange until you have about 1 tablespoon of zest. Then cut the orange in half and use a citrus squeezer to extract the juice. You will need about 1/3 cup of juice. In a small mason jar shake all of the vinaigrette ingredients together until well combined.

Instructions. In a small mixing bowl, whisk together the honey, balsamic, mustard, salt, pepper and garlic. Add the oil and whisk thoroughly to combine. Continue whisking until the dressing is fully emulsified. Store in a jar with a lid and refrigerate. Shake well before serving.

If using xanthan gum, sprinkle on the vinaigrette and whisk vigorously for 15 seconds. Then transfer to a jar or bottle and shake until it thickens. Store at room temperature for 2 days or refrigerate for 10 days in a sealed bottle or jar. Shake well before using.
